Self-catering groups

The house is ideal for self-catering group stays or away days for up to 10 people – for example for meditation retreats, writing or music workshops.  By using the house in this way, group participants are also helping to finance Sanctuary Breaks.  

We ask all visitors to help with the cleaning and daily care of the house, so we can keep rates low and enable a wide range of visitors to enjoy the space.  It is also possible to spend time at the house in partial or full exchange for work on the house or garden.

There is wheelchair access to the ground floor.

Apart from day visits, the house is not suitable for families with toddlers.

Individual stays

If you would like to come for an individual retreat for a few days mid-week, we can make arrangements to suit you. There may be some work going on around you in the house or garden, which you could join in with or not as you choose. We are happy to accept work-exchange stays as well.

We ask all visitors to help with the cleaning and daily care of the house, so we can keep rates low and enable a wide range of visitors to enjoy the space.

Hill House

Hill House is situated in a delightful Cotswold village on the edge of Minchinhampton Common.

There are five double, twin or triple bedrooms, 2 bathrooms, 2 comfortable reception rooms, a spacious dining room, a well-equipped modern kitchen, and a large garden. The garden specialises in some huge and unusual trees. At present the house does not easily lend itself to wheelchair access. It is also not suitable for groups of young children. 

Beautiful Cotswold walks outside the door take you across Minchinhampton Common to the Cotswold village of Minchinhampton or you can walk into the wild garlic-filled woods down the hill below the house, Nailsworth is within walking distance too (a steep hill tho!) where you will find independent shops (Hobbs Bakery, Williams Kitchen, The Yellow-Lighted Bookshop) and plentiful restaurants and cafes. Stroud is famous for its Farmers Market held every Saturday. And the village of Amberley has a wonderful community cafe and shop, with a visiting mobile bakery (Salt Bakehouse) on Tuesdays.
